HR 2299 · 113th Congress · Finance and Financial Sector

To prevent the Secretary of the Treasury from expanding United States bank reporting requirements with respect to interest on deposits paid to nonresident aliens.

Introduced 2013-06-06· Sponsored by Rep. Posey, Bill [R-FL-8]· House

Latest: Referred to the House Committee on Ways and Means.(2013-06-06)

Plain Language Summary

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Prohibits the Secretary of the Treasury from requiring a payor of interest to file an information return on interest that is not effectively connected with a trade or business within the United States and that is paid to a nonresident alien on a deposit maintained at an office within the United States.…
